The paper examines the possibility of operating the VSC (Voltage Source Converter)-based HVDC (High Voltage Direct Current) Tyrrhenian Link-East with grid-forming capabil-ities. The investigations are focused on the frequency transients, and on the possible contribution which can be provided by the Tyrrhenian Link-East to the system. This infrastructure has a strategic importance, and it is designed to support the energy transition enabling a greater integration of renewable energy sources. The dynamic analysis is performed on a simplified 10-bus simulation model of the continental Italian transmission system linked to an equivalent Sicilian network, and it examines different types of contingencies. The results preliminarily suggest that the Tyrrhenian Link-East can effectively contribute to the frequency control of the system, and that the grid-forming capability represents a valid opportunity for the operation of the VSC-HVDC converters of the link.
